Step-by-Step: How to Upgrade Your Workshop Systems
You don’t need to do everything at once.
Step 1 – Start with Job Cards
Digitise your job cards first. This is where most of your daily work happens.
Step 2 – Add Customer Management
Keep all customer and vehicle history in one place.
Step 3 – Move to Digital Invoicing
Generate invoices directly from completed jobs.
Step 4 – Track Your Workflow
Use your system to see:
- Jobs in progress
- Completed jobs
- Delays or bottlenecks
Common Challenges (And How to Overcome Them)
Switching systems can feel uncomfortable at first.
Here’s how to handle it:
- “My team won’t adapt” → Keep training simple and practical
- “It feels slower at first” → Give it a few days—it gets faster quickly
- “I don’t trust digital systems” → Choose a reliable, workshop-focused tool
Consistency is key. Don’t switch back to paper when things feel new.
